Premature blood stem cell aging in sickle cell disease may be reversible
Medical Xpress

Sickle cell disease causes premature aging of blood stem cells, which scientists may be able to address with a special class of drugs, according to a new study from St.
Jude Children's Research Hospital.
Patients with sickle cell disease experience higher rates of blood stem cell dysfunction and blood cancers compared with their peers, though the reason has been unclear. ...
